3. Add Elegance with Wainscoting

Install modern wood paneling only on the bottom third of the wall to create a refined look. Wainscoting helps break up wall space, lends architectural interest, and provides durability in high-traffic areas.

How to Execute a Flawless Paneling Project

Here are a few practical pointers to help ensure your modern wood paneling makeover goes smoothly:

Do:

  • Choose panel materials suited for the room’s humidity levels
  • Measure carefully for symmetrical installation
  • Prime and paint with finishes that suit your décor

Don’t:

  • Skip surface prep – uneven walls ruin clean lines
  • Forget sealing – especially in kitchens and bathrooms
  • Overdo it – subtle use of paneling often has the most impact

Types of Modern Wood Paneling to Consider

Below is a description list outlining various styles:

Shiplap Clean-lined boards that fit snugly together, offering a modern rustic appearance.

Beadboard Featuring small ridges between planks, it adds subtle texture and charm to bathrooms and breakfast nooks.

Board and Batten Combines wide planks with narrow vertical strips, ideal for feature walls and entryways.

Slatted Panels Perfect for a minimalist aesthetic, these are thin vertical wood slats with visible spacing.

FAQs About Modern Wood Paneling

What rooms are best suited for modern wood paneling? Any room can benefit, but it’s especially popular in living rooms, bedrooms, bathrooms, and kitchens.

Can I install wood paneling myself? Yes. With basic tools and measurements, DIY installation is feasible. Just ensure your walls are level and clean.

Is wood paneling expensive? It depends on the type. MDF and pine are affordable, while hardwoods and custom designs increase costs.

Can modern wood paneling be painted? Absolutely. Paint enhances flexibility and can suit almost any style or mood.

How do I maintain wood paneling? Wipe regularly with a dry or slightly damp cloth. For painted panels, touch up scuffs with leftover paint.
